One of the many new features of SMS 2003 Service Pack 2 is the "Active
Directory Security Group" Discovery Method.
- As it's name suggests you can now discover AD
Security Groups without having to use the AD User or AD System Group
Discovery methods.
- Discovery of nested groups is supported and
optionally configurable.
- A new Collection and Query called "All Active
Directory Security Groups" will appear in the SP2 version of the SMS
Administrator Console that will contain any groups discovered by this
Discovery Method (the "Adsgdis.log"
also contains information about the groups discovered by this Discovery
Method).
- Collection objects are the actual group names
and NOT the individual members of the group. This allows you to target
the without having to update the group membership to pick up any changes
(additions/ deletions of resources).
